In the low-altitude economy, the selection of frequency standards is crucial for communication between drones and other low-altitude flying vehicles. Here are some key frequency standards and related information:

Major Frequency Standards

1. 1430-1444 MHz:

- This frequency band is specifically designated for telemetry and downlink information transmission for civil unmanned aerial vehicles (UAVs). The use of this band ensures effective data transmission during drone flights.

2. 2400-2476 MHz:

- This band is widely used for short-range wireless communication, including control and data transmission for drones. It is a common frequency range for many consumer-grade drones.

3. 5725-5829 MHz:

- This band is also utilized for radio communication of drones, particularly in applications that require higher data transmission rates.

4. Millimeter Wave Band (30 GHz - 300 GHz):

- The millimeter wave band provides a wide bandwidth suitable for high data transmission rates, especially in 5G and future 6G networks, supporting precise control and rapid data exchange for low-altitude flying vehicles.

5. 5G-A (5G Advanced):

- As an evolution of 5G technology, 5G-A can utilize millimeter waves and sub-6GHz bands to provide low-latency, high-bandwidth communication capabilities for drones in the low-altitude economy.

Application Background

1. Integration of Sensing and Communication:

- The integration of communication and sensing technologies in the low-altitude economy requires efficient utilization of spectrum resources to achieve dynamic scheduling in time, frequency, and airspace.

2. Regulation and Management:

- These frequency bands are typically subject to strict regulation to ensure the stability and safety of communications while avoiding interference and conflicts.

3. International Coordination:

- As the low-altitude economy develops, international coordination on spectrum resources becomes increasingly important to facilitate global market expansion.

By rationally planning and effectively utilizing these frequency standards, the development of the low-altitude economy can be supported, enhancing the operational efficiency and safety of drones and other flying vehicles.
